** The GMC repair market in Broken Bow, Nebraska, reflects its status as a rural hub for a large agricultural and recreational area. The market is characterized by a small number of providers but a high demand for competent truck and SUV service, especially for diesel and 4WD systems used in farming, ranching, and towing. * **Average Quality:** The quality is generally good to very good. The presence of a dedicated GMC dealership (H&H) sets a high bar for specialization and technical resources. The independent shops that thrive do so by building strong reputations for honesty and expertise, particularly with the diesel engines common in the area. * **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ate but reputation-based. There are not dozens of shops, so each established business has a solid customer base. Success is driven by word-of-mouth and long-term trust within the community rather than marketing alone.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ows a standard tiered structure. The dealership (H&H) commands premium rates for its factory-trained technicians, specialized diagnostics, and OEM parts. Independent shops like B-Drive Auto & Diesel offer competitive, often lower, labor rates while maintaining high quality, making them an excellent value for non-warranty mechanical work. Shops like M & M Service Center typically offer the most budget-friendly option for routine services.
